Description: For my senior year capstone, students were placed in project groups and had roughly eight weeks to deliver a software project. AdLib is the resulting project. AdLib is a web content management system (CMS). The purpose of AdLib is for new artists in the advertising game to have a place to show off their work, vote and comment on other artists' work, and possibly get their ad noticed by corporations.
Challenges: AdLib was initially coded in C# using the .NET framework with a SQL Server backend database. DotNetNuke was used to handle site registration and other basic functionality. We had connectivity issues with the database and a small amount of time to have a project up and running. As implementation manager, I made the call to scrap the project and start from scratch with three weeks remaining before the first presentation. We changed from C# to PHP and from SQL Server to MySQL.
